Hi,

I'm trying to import some models ripped from other games.

https://discord.com/channels/488393111014342656/631752549321539594/1144893890395111484

However dhewm3 doesn't like this:

dhewm3: /drive/src/dhewm3_vk_rt/neo/renderer/Model_md5.cpp:238: void idMD5Mesh::ParseMesh(idLexer&, int, const idJointMat*): Assertion `(texCoords.Num() * sizeof( idDrawVert ))<ID_MAX_ALLOCA_SIZE' failed.


Looks like dhewm3 1.5.3pre crashed with signal SIGABRT (6) - sorry!

These models are much more detailed than doom3 was initially meant to handle. Is this fixable or should I forget about this altogether?
